it seems like everything you can connect to a tv or monitor has an hdmi port but somehow displayport which is largely able to just do the same thing has stuck around for years on our computers so whats the point of having two connectors that are seemingly interchangeable well it turns out hdmi and displayport were designed with different uses in mind hdmi hit the scene in 2003 and was mostly backed by companies involved in the home theater side of consumer electronics think panasonic phillips and sony for example digital cable boxes hd tvs and dvd players were starting to take off and movie and tv studios worked with the companies that made these devices on a connection that supported copy protection displayport on the other hand didnt come along until 2008 and was designed specifically with computers in mind by vasa the same folks that standardized those mounting holes so you could stick a big screen on your wall vasa members included big players in the pc industry such as intel am

Header graphics should be between 600-700 pixels wide, with a proportional height (we use 100-200px as a general guideline for height).
Most headers are set up to use the full width of the page. The height generally for a home page header is around 600 pixels high. For a content page header, this might be slightly smaller at around 300 pixels.
The most common size for a web pages header is still 1024 pixels wide, despite the fact that screens are getting larger. Websites are built to be viewed at a resolution of 1024 x 768 pixels. For the best experience on a retina display, youll want to double the size of your image; for instance, if you have a 640px header graphic, youd upload a 1280px version.
1. Full-Screen and Banner Image Dimensions. The ideal size for a full-screen hero image is 1,200 pixels wide with a 16:9 aspect ratio. For a banner hero image, the ideal size is 1600 x 500 pixels.
